Pflugerville - Persons with Co-Occurring Mental and Substance Abuse Disorders

Many treatment programs in Pflugerville, Texas address persons with co-occurring mental and substance abuse disorders. A person who struggles with a mental disorder(s) and substance abuse requires to work through both issues at the same time. Failing to deal with the client's mental disorder(s) during their drug rehabilitation will leave them susceptible to relapse once they leave treatment. Troubles with mood disorders, anxiety disorders and other mental disorders (schizophrenia, personality disorders, etc.) will come up once back in their day to day life. If the individual does not have a grip on how to deal with their mental disorder they will probably fall back into their old ways of abusing drugs or alcohol as a means of coping and self-medicating.
